Transaction 58f4e48cca85792fc3ef267e7b5b880c6d43bc03f8a54d07d4fa66388d73f75a

1 Input
2 Outputs
  • 58f4e48cca85792fc3ef267e7b5b880c6d43bc03f8a54d07d4fa66388d73f75a:0
  • value  13831393
    address  12nSLToV2JCTy1RWLycG7wwe5xYM6vE3fA
  • 58f4e48cca85792fc3ef267e7b5b880c6d43bc03f8a54d07d4fa66388d73f75a:1
  • value  88898609
    address  3MPkADwDm98i9g6tTo8VpijNTtSReF5cC6